Just consider how many things you use each day that utilise electronics in one way or another. For these items to work properly the electronic components have to be set out in a particular order. Once the cover is removed from one of these items it becomes easier to see how this is fulfilled.
On opening up one of these items you will immediately notice a flat board. This will normally either be brown or green in colour, and is called the printed circuit board. You will notice that there are metallic tracks on one side. These tracks are used to conduct power only where it is meant to go.
Printed circuit boards will be one of two basic types. The type used is often decided by the function that the customer wishes to achieve, and the space available to fit all of these components in. The different types are known as through board and surface mount.
No matter which type of board it is, there are certain skills needed to create one. If you don't have a keen eye and a steady hand creating one of these circuit boards becomes very frustrating. People will still need to be made aware about which component is which, and how they need fitting.
The through board is the most likely type that people will come across. It does have certain advantages. The components are all situated on the other side to the metallic tracks. The component's legs are fed through the board, hence the name. The legs are soldered to the metal tracks which conducts power through the component and also holds them securely in place. The legs are clipped to prevent them sticking trough too far, and possibly becoming a short circuit. The components are of a size that enable easier handling.
The components on the other type of board are securely soldered to the tracks. In themselves the components are much smaller, and so need greater care when being handled. To assemble this type of board high magnification is required as well as good lighting. This will help to eliminate the possibility of badly soldered joints.
When the technician is happy that all of these components sit in their right places on the circuit board, they will then apply a conformal coating.
